Output efc3010d0d4ac967882e95da5b32946a0f0baa44542cf0c31faed4a1978ea74e:44

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f90afdbf6a634494c7ee2f5262785d87c6b200c873595086b9b58ff0a06fc38a
address
bc1ply90m0m2vdzff3lw9afxy7zaslrtyqxgwdv4pp4ekk8lpgr0cw9qwxaa2l
transaction
efc3010d0d4ac967882e95da5b32946a0f0baa44542cf0c31faed4a1978ea74e
spent
true